Peterborough United can be quick to dispense of managers when results have not gone well. The Posh have now had forty-three managers since 1934. Darren Ferguson returning in 2023 meant that the club has also changed managers eleven times since 2010. Ferguson himself has now chosen the team on four separate occasions in those 13 years. List of Peterborough United Managers
Here is a complete list of all Peterborough United managers on record with information on length of service and win ratio. Who will be the next Peterborough United manager on the list?
Manager | Appointment Date | To | Days in Charge | Win Rate |
---|---|---|---|---|
Darren Ferguson | 4 Jan, 2023 | 17/08/2025 | 956 | |
Grant McCann | 25 Feb, 2022 | 4 Jan, 2023 | 313 | 37.50% |
Matthew Etherington | 22 Feb, 2022 | 25 Feb, 2022 | 3 | 0.00% |
Darren Ferguson | 27 Jan, 2019 | 22 Feb, 2022 | 1122 | 50.86% |
Steve Evans | 1 Mar, 2018 | 26 Jan, 2019 | 331 | 40.38% |
David Oldfield | 26 Feb, 2018 | 1 Mar, 2018 | 3 | 100.00% |
Grant McCann | 23 Apr, 2016 | 26 Feb, 2018 | 674 | 39.40% |
Graham Westley | 21 Sep, 2015 | 23 Apr, 2016 | 215 | 43.90% |
Grant McCann | 08 Sep, 2015 | 21 Sep, 2015 | 13 | 50.00% |
David Robertson | 21 Feb, 2015 | 08 Sep, 2015 | 199 | 35.00% |
Darren Ferguson | 12 Jan, 2011 | 21 February, 2015 | 1501 | 39.64% |
Gary Johnson | 06 Apr, 2010 | 10 Jan, 2011 | 279 | 45.45% |
Jim Gannon | 02 Feb, 2010 | 06 Apr, 2010 | 63 | 28.57% |
Mark Cooper | 16 Nov, 2009 | 01 Feb, 2010 | 77 | 7.69% |
Darren Ferguson | 21 Jan, 2007 | 9 Nov, 2009 | 1023 | 50.34% |
Tommy Taylor | 15 Jan, 2007 | 20 Jan, 2007 | 5 | 0.00% |
Keith Alexander | 30 May, 2006 | 15 Jan, 2007 | 230 | 41.18% |
Steve Bleasdale | 26 Jan, 2006 | 30 May, 2006 | 124 | 42.86% |
Mark Wright | 31 May, 2005 | 25 Jan, 2006 | 239 | 34.29% |
Barry Fry | 01 Aug, 1996 | 31 May, 2005 | 3225 | 33.33% |
Mick Halsall | 24 Oct, 1995 | 31 July, 1996 | 281 | 32.26% |
John Still | 1 Aug, 1994 | 24 Oct, 1995 | 449 | 29.17% |
Lil Fuccillo | 01 Dec, 1992 | 29 Dec, 1993 | 393 | 25.86% |
Christopher Turner | 22 Jan, 1991 | 01 Dec, 1992 | 679 | 48.28% |
Dave Booth | 16 Nov, 1990 | 12 Jan, 1991 | 415 | 23.53% |
Mark Lawrenson | 6 Sep, 1989 | 9 Nov, 1990 | 429 | 38.24% |
Mick Jones | 12 Jul, 1988 | 31 Aug, 1989 | 415 | 30.51% |
Noel Cantwell | 19 Nov, 1986 | 12 Jul, 1988 | 601 | 42.22% |
John Wile | 01 May, 1983 | 1 Nov, 1986 | 1280 | 33.15% |
Martin Wilkinson | 29 Jun, 1982 | 01 Feb, 1983 | 217 | 33.84% |
Peter Morris | 24 February, 1979 | 25 May, 1982 | 1186 | 42.70% |
Billy Hails | 1 Nov, 1978 | 15 February, 1979 | 106 | 19.04% |
John Barnwell | 10 May, 1977 | 9 Nov, 1978 | 548 | 40.00% |
Noel Cantwell | 09 Oct, 1972 | 10 May, 1977 | 1674 | 41.67% |
Jim Iley | 01 Jan, 1969 | 30 Sep, 1972 | 1368 | 36.26% |
Norman Rigby | 01 Sep, 1967 | 01 January, 1969 | 488 | 38.57% |
Gordon Clark | 01 Apr, 1964 | 01 Sep, 1967 | 1248 | 41.04% |
Jack Fairbrother | 01 Dec, 1962 | 1 Feb, 1964 | 427 | 30.36% |
Jimmy Hagan | 01 Aug, 1958 | 01 Oct, 1962 | 1522 | 64.36% |
George Swindin | 01 Aug, 1954 | 31 May, 1958 | 1399 | 66.36% |
Jack Fairbrother | 01 Aug, 1952 | 31 May, 1954 | 668 | 50.00% |
Bob Gurney | 01 Aug, 1950 | 31 May, 1952 | 669 | 42.53% |
Jack Blood | 01 Aug, 1948 | 31 May, 1950 | 668 | 44.58% |
Sam Madden | 01 Aug, 1938 | 31 May, 1948 | 3591 | 49.16% |
Vic Poulter | 01 Aug, 1937 | 31 May, 1938 | 303 | 17.78% |
Fred Taylor | 01 Aug, 1936 | 31 May, 1937 | 303 | 37.57% |
Jock Porter | 01 August, 1934 | 31 May, 1936 | 669 | 35.21% |

Who was the first manager of Peterborough United
Between 1934 and 1936, Jock Porter was in charge of Posh; he was Peterborough United's first manager.
Who is the longest-serving manager of Peterborough United
Sam Madden managed Peterborough United before and after the Second World War (August 1938-May 1948). More recently, the legendary Barry Fry was in charge between August 1996 and May 2005, when he was also the club's chairman. Madden was the boss for 3591 days and Fry for 3225.
Who is the shortest-serving manager of Peterborough United
Jim Gannon was at Peterborough for just 63 days and was at the helm for only fourteen games between February and April 2010 making him the shortest serving manager of Peterborough United. Running a close second, Mark Cooper lasted just 77 days between 2009 and 2010.
Which Peterborough United Manager Has Been The Most Successful
Darren Ferguson won the Football League Trophy in 2014 + via the playoffs won promotion to the Championship in 2011. His teams also were League One runners-up twice and League Two runners-up once making him the most successful manager of Peterborough United
Which Peterborough United Manager Has The Best Win Percentage
Two managers achieved a very impressive 60% + win rate while in charge at Peterborough United.
- 1954-1958 George Swindin 66.36%
- 1958-1962 Jimmy Hagan 64.36%
Which Peterborough United Manager Had The Worst Win Percentage
The lowest winning percentage or win rate of any Peterborough manager in history is from Mark Cooper. He had a poor record of W1 D4 L8, a win rate of just 7.7%.
